Nerds, let's jump in to episode 3 of Journey Back to Namibia.
In episode 3, Ryan & Nadia jump into one of the most important topics for rural people in Namibia. Food & farming. They are joined by two farmers, Uaperendua & Joseph to hear about how farming has changed during the drought & what support they need to be able to provide food security for their community.
Guest appearances: Uaperendua Muzuma & Joseph Muzuma - farmers in Ehi Rovipuka Conservancy. Siegfried Muzuma - conservancy committee member & our translator for this episode.
